Canalplay
CanalPlay is an accessible service of legal remote loading of vidéos on Internet starting from a PC (portable or not).
CANALPLAY proposes a great choice of programs to order when it is wished. Once that the film was downloaded on the hard disk of the computer via Internet, it can be preserved for one one month duration and be viewed in the 24 hours which follow the starting of the visionnage (useless connection Internet for the reading of the video as from the moment when the remote loading is finished). Accessible since October 12, 2005 starting from a PC on www.CANALPLAY.COM, CANALPLAY proposes a supply of vidéos to be downloaded with.
